Course Curriculum Overview

5

I was always into computer science whch is why i took this field. I have chosen B.E CSE which is core computer science so this helps me figure out which field i want to go in. They teach us using presentations, simulations, etc. We are also give us exposure through Industrial Visits. Curriculum is good overall.

Internships Opportunities

5

There were some startup companies which came in and took interns through proper interview process. Some interns excelled and there for got stipend upto 15000. We are encouraged to work with our seniors on their projects which gives us exposure.

Placement Experience

5

Our college bring in a lot of top tier companys TCS, Zoho, Amazon, google, microsoft. There are students who have got in to companies with a 50LPA package. Placements have been getting better as time goes on. Many startup companies also recruit interns from our college.

Fees and Financial Aid

We pay 1.5 lakh per month. Scholarship does apply. We get reduction according to our 12th marks during management. Minimum of 80% is required in PCM for counselling. We do get scholarships for few communties according to our parents LPA

Campus Life

5

There are many clubs like campus life, yrc, nss, enlit,etc. All these clubs are run by students. They conduct many events. We have weekly events, hackathons, concerts, etc. Our classrooms are very spacious with whiteboards, comfortable seats,etc.

Admission

I did apply for SRM Ramapuram, SSN, St.josephs etc, but i chose easwari for its academics and college life balance. There are so many things to enjoy here. The environment is very pleasing and welcoming. We also get exposure to other colleges.

Faculty

5

The faculties are highly trained and welll educated in their fields. Most of them are friendly and help us. There are some faculties who are extremely strict which brings down the overall confidance of students. As far as exam goes, CATs are very tough compared to semester exams. We have monthly examinations, which are Unit tests, CAT, End Semester examination. Unit test and CAT marks are integrated in the internals.Unit tests are for 25 marks, CATs for 50 marks and Semester is for 100 marks. 80 marks are taken out of our end sem and 20 marks from internals which include unit test, cat, projects, assignments, records, and group presentation.
